Where does “širšė” come from?
širšė (Lithuanian) comes from Lithuanian širšuo, from Proto-Balto-Slavic śiršō, from Proto-Indo-European ḱerh₂s-, from Proto-Indo-European ḱerh₂- — head, top; horn.
širšė (Lithuanian): hornet
Ancestry of “širšė”, step by step
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|
| 1 | Lithuanian | širšuo | — |
| 2 | Proto-Balto-Slavic | śiršō | hornet |
| 3 | Proto-Indo-European | ḱerh₂s- | head; hornet |
| 4 | Proto-Indo-European | ḱerh₂- | head, top; horn |
